在日常工作中,我们常常需要将PDF文档转换为可编辑的文本文件(如TXT格式),以便于进一步处理或分析。然而,在进行这种转换时,许多用户可能会遇到一个令人头疼的问题——乱码现象。本文将从多个角度探讨这一问题的原因及其解决方案。
一、乱码产生的主要原因
1. 编码格式不匹配
PDF文档中存储的文字信息通常是以特定的编码方式保存的,而当转换工具无法正确识别这些编码时,就会导致文字显示错误,从而产生乱码。例如,中文PDF可能使用GB2312编码,但如果转换工具默认采用UTF-8编码,则容易出现乱码。
2. 字体缺失或损坏
某些PDF文档依赖于特殊的字体来呈现文字内容。如果目标设备上缺少这些字体,或者字体本身存在损坏情况,那么转换后的TXT文件中就可能出现乱码。
3. 复杂排版结构的影响
高度复杂的PDF文档可能包含表格、图片嵌入以及多语言混合等元素。这些因素会增加转换过程中的技术难度,进而可能导致部分字符未能被准确提取出来。
4. 转换工具的功能局限性
不同类型的PDF转换软件其功能强大程度各异。一些简单的小型工具可能不具备足够的算法支持来应对所有类型的PDF文件,这也可能是造成乱码的一个重要原因。
二、有效应对策略
针对上述原因,我们可以采取以下措施来尽量避免或解决PDF转TXT时出现的乱码问题:
1. 使用专业的PDF转换软件
选择一款专业且功能全面的PDF转换器至关重要。这类软件往往具备更强的数据解析能力,能够更好地处理各种编码格式,并且对特殊字体的支持也更为完善。推荐尝试使用Adobe Acrobat Pro DC这样的行业领先产品,它不仅提供了强大的PDF编辑功能,还拥有出色的转换性能。
2. 手动调整编码设置
在使用某些基础级转换工具时,可以尝试手动更改输出文件的编码选项。比如,对于含有大量中文字符的PDF文档,可以选择“GBK”或“GB2312”作为输出编码类型,这样有助于提高文字还原准确性。
3. 提前检查并安装必要字体
如果怀疑是由于字体缺失引起的乱码问题,可以在转换之前先查看PDF文档所使用的字体列表,并确保目标系统已安装了这些字体。此外,还可以通过导出PDF中的字体资源到本地的方式来进行补充。
4. 分步骤逐步转换
面对特别复杂的PDF文档时,不妨将其拆分成若干个小节分别进行转换,然后再将各部分结果合并起来。这种方法虽然稍显繁琐,但却能有效减少因一次性加载过多数据而导致的混乱情况发生几率。
5. 寻求在线服务的帮助
若自己操作起来比较困难的话,也可以考虑借助互联网上的免费在线转换平台来完成任务。不过需要注意的是,在上传敏感资料之前务必确认该网站的安全性和隐私保护政策是否符合要求。
三、总结
总之,要想成功地将PDF转换为无误码的TXT文档并非易事,但只要掌握了正确的思路与技巧,再配合合适的工具和方法,相信大多数情况下都能够顺利完成这项工作。希望以上提供的建议对你有所帮助!